Foreign Minister S. Jaishankar expressed concern over anarchy in Bangladesh, said – If neighbors are good then help is also natural

Tezzbuzz Desk- Indian Foreign Minister Dr. S. Jaishankar, while participating in an event organized in Tamil Nadu, spoke on India’s foreign policy and approach towards neighboring countries. He specifically mentioned the ongoing lawlessness and instability in Bangladesh.

Jaishankar said that India always cooperates with those neighboring countries which are friendly to us. “Whichever neighboring country is good for us, we invest there and try to help them,” he said.

The External Affairs Minister further said that he had visited Bangladesh two days ago, where he attended the funeral of former Prime Minister Begum Khaleda Zia as a representative of India. He said that during this time he met many different types of neighbors and his experience made it clear that kindness and cooperation come naturally in relationships when there are good neighbors.

Jaishankar also stressed that India as a country has always believed that helping neighbors and enhancing cooperation is important not only strategically but also from a humanitarian point of view.
